Explain how ethene is a feedstock for making ethanol.

Answer :

BeckaH BeckaH
  • 30-01-2015
Ethene can react with steam to create ethanol under certain conditions. In this reaction, ethene can be considered a feedstock as it is a reactant so you need to use it to get the ethanol you want.
